North Dakota Cowboy Hall of Fame

North Dakota Cowboy Hall of Fame

The Hall, a bastion of the rich western heritage of North Dakota, was officially established in 1995 and opened its doors in 2005.

International Peace Garden

International Peace Garden

The Garden, situated on the border of North Dakota and Manitoba, Canada, offers a rich array of educational programs and field trip opportunities tailored for students of all ages.
